Why are steering wheels getting stolen?
They’re mostly after airbags in Chevy Malibus and Equinoxes. So certain shady repair shops are looking for airbags; any airbags. They’ll pay cash on the spot-no questions asked. They are even selling the steering wheel assemblies with the airbags inside to victims of steering wheel thefts.

How is the steering column connected to the suspension?
The steering column is connected to the suspension of a vehicle. More specifically, the steering column is the link between the steering wheel and the steering mechanism of a vehicle. This means that when a driver turns the steering wheel with their hands, the steering column is transferring this torque power to the steering shaft and pinion.
